There is a situation of datafeed of Binance: Too many tick per second.
That will make the MC crash all the time, I have check the Binance have provide the two kind of data stream:
1.Aggregate Trade Streams - The Aggregate Trade Streams push trade information that is aggregated for a single taker order.
2.Trade Streams - The Trade Streams push raw trade information; each trade has a unique buyer and seller.
Can MC team can consider to give a option, let the datafeed can choice which kind of data stream going to use in Binance?
the Aggregate looks like can solve the problem of too many ticks.
